Description
Rare pair of easy chairs model F60 designed by Karl-Erik Ekselius. Produced by JOC in Vetlanda, Sweden.
-
More Information
Documentation: Documented elsewhere (exact item) Origin: Sweden Period: 1950-1979 Materials: Chromed steel and original red leather Condition: Vintage condition, with signs of usage and repairs on leather Creation Date: 1960's Number of Pieces: 2-3 Styles / Movements: Modern, Scandinavian Modern Dealer Reference #: 125138 Incollect Reference #: 457126 -
Dimensions
W. 27.56 in; H. 29.53 in; D. 29.53 in; W. 70 cm; H. 75 cm; D. 75 cm; Seat H. 16.14 in; Seat H. 41 cm;
